News ArticlesBambolim project: order withdrawnNT Staff Reporter Panaji, Jan 25 The additional collector – North Goa, Mr Swapnil Naik today lifted the “stop work” order against the controversial Aldeia de Goa project at Bambolim in accordance with the assurance given to the High Court by the advocate general recently. Mr Naik has also scheduled a hearing for both the parties – the builder and the Goa Bachao Abhiyan on January 31. Mr Naik told The Navhind Times that he will give an opportunity to both sides to present their cases on January 31 and then decide on the issue. He said the “stop work” order was issued after the Goa Bachao Abhiyan led an agitation alleging irregularities in the Bambolim project. Subsequently, the builders had approached the court alleging that they had not been given a hearing before the “stop work” order was issued. So the order has now been lifted to give an opportunity to both sides to present their cases. Meanwhile, GBA sources said they had a meeting today with the Chief Secretary, Mr J P Singh and explained the facts. Mr Singh reportedly told the GBA that he will discuss the issue with the Chief Minister and revert to the GBA. |
